What Is Ashwagandha?
Ashwagandha (Withania somnifera) is a well-known adaptogenic herb used in Ayurveda for thousands of years. Adaptogens help the body cope with stress and maintain internal balance.
Research suggests Ashwagandha may help support stress reduction, improved sleep quality, and overall mental well-being.
Key benefits of Ashwagandha
- Helps manage stress and anxiety
- Supports better sleep quality
- May improve focus and cognitive performance
- Supports energy and stamina
- May help balance hormones
Because of these benefits, Ashwagandha is often used by people dealing with stress, fatigue, and sleep issues.
What Is Shilajit?
Shilajit is a natural mineral-rich resin that forms over centuries in mountainous regions such as the Himalayas. It contains fulvic acid, antioxidants, and more than 80 trace minerals that support overall health.
Shilajit has been traditionally used in Ayurveda as a rejuvenating substance for strength, stamina, and vitality.
Key benefits of Shilajit
- Helps increase energy and stamina
- Supports physical performance
- May improve testosterone levels and fertility
- Supports cognitive function and brain health
- Provides antioxidant and anti-aging support
Because of these properties, Shilajit is commonly used for physical vitality and endurance.
Ashwagandha vs Shilajit: Key Differences
| Feature | Ashwagandha | Shilajit |
|---|---|---|
| Type | Adaptogenic herb | Mineral-rich resin |
| Primary benefit | Stress relief & relaxation | Energy & stamina |
| Best for | Stress, sleep, mental wellness | Strength, vitality, endurance |
| Key compounds | Withanolides | Fulvic acid & minerals |
| Common users | People with stress, sleep problems | Athletes, fitness enthusiasts |
In simple terms:
- Ashwagandha → Mental balance and stress management
- Shilajit → Physical energy and vitality
This is why they are often recommended for different wellness goals.

Can You Take Ashwagandha and Shilajit Together?
Yes. In Ayurveda, Ashwagandha and Shilajit are sometimes combined because they complement each other.
Potential combined benefits include:
- Better stress resilience
- Improved physical energy
- Enhanced mental clarity
- Improved overall vitality
However, it is always best to consult a healthcare professional before combining supplements.
